High street coffee shop giant Starbucks has been caught up in a child labour row after an investigation revealed that children under 13 were working on farms in Guatemala that supply the chain with its beans. At the beginning of 2024, 63 million girls and 97 million boys were in child labor, accounting for about 1 in 10 children worldwide. About 70% of these children — 112 million — work in agriculture, mostly in farming and livestock herding. Across all age groups, boys are more likely to work than girls. イソビスト

The revelations released by The Guardian detailed how five coffee farms in the Starbucks supply chain had been found to employ children under the age of 13 to work incredibly hard 40-hour weeks picking coffee beans.

WebbWhen Ethical Consumer viewed the Starbucks DEF 14A SEC Filings, they saw it stated that Howard Schultz had been paid a total of $17,980,890 in 2024. Five other directors also received annual salaries of between $2million and $12million. Each of these figures soared well beyond the $1,000,000 that Ethical Consumer deems to be excessive pay.
